VIRGINHALL Church was in Penpont - a small village 2 miles 3 km west of Thornhill in Dumfriesshire in the Dumfries and Galloway region of Scotland. It is near the confluence of the Shinnel Water and Scaur Water rivers in the foothills of the Southern Uplands. It has a population of about 400 people. SCARCE. "Rose Fenemore is taking a break from her Cambridge teaching post in an isolated cottage on the Hebridean island of Moila. One evening, she is shocked to discover an attractive stranger, Ewen Mackay, in her kitchen, who claims to have grown up in the cottage. She is tempted to believe him when another man seeks shelter from the storm. John Parsons also rouses Rose's skepticism and more tender feelings as well. And as the truth about the two men unfolds, the stormy petrels, fragile elusive birds who fly close to the waves, come to symbolize Rose's confusion and the mystery of her future." Book
